正常我们在mysql官网下载安装的MySQL比较大,因为它集成了好多东西,尽管方便,但是东西比较多,有些我们可能不想要,这时我们可以直接下载单个MySQL Server安装,所以这篇文章主要介绍的就是在window环境下安装MySQL Server 5.7.21,具体内容如下:

1. 从MySQL官网下载安装包:mysql-5.7.21-winx64.msi
2. 安装到默认的目录(本人安装到C:\Program Files\MySQL\MySQL Server 5.7)

3. 配置环境变量,将MySQL的启动目录(C:\Program Files\MySQL\MySQL Server 5.7\bin)添加到Path中,如图所示:


4. 在MySQL目录下(C:\Program Files\MySQL\MySQL Server 5.7)创建my.ini文件,内容如下:

[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
#设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=C:\Program Files\MySQL\MySQL Server 5.7
# 设置mysql数据库的数据的存放目录
datadir=C:\Program Files\MySQL\MySQL Server 5.7\data
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B 

5. 管理员身份运行cmd
    5.1切换目录进入到bin目录:
cd C:\Program Files\MySQL\MySQL Server 5.7\bin  
    5.2在bin目录下生成MySQL服务:
mysqld -install
    然后安装成功会提示:
Service successfully installed.
    5.3在C:\Program Files\MySQL\MySQL Server 5.7\下生成data目录:
mysqld --initialize-insecure --user=mysql 
    5.4启动MySQL服务:
net start mysql 
然后会提示,最后提示启动成功
MySQL 服务正在启动 . 
MySQL 服务已经启动成功。
而且通过services.msc命令进入服务能够看到MySQL正在运行
6. 登录数据库,修改密码(默认密码为空)
    6.1登录数据库:
mysql -uroot -p
提示输入密码,默认是为空,我们直接enter键进入下一步,如图所示

    6.2修改密码:
首先可以通过命令查看一下默认有哪些数据库
show databases;

然后切换到数据库:mysql,进行更改密码(如果不切换,会报错),如图所示:

use mysql; 
进行密码更改
update user set authentication_string=password("新密码") where User="root"; 
最后要进行刷新,否则更改密码无效
FLUSH PRIVILEGES;

注意:当我们的数据库命令出现错误时,可以通过\c,\q退出,\c是退出到mysql>,\q退出是到命令行:C:\Windows\system32>,如图所示:

7.退出服务
通过\q退出到命令行路径,然后通过以下命令关闭服务,这时服务列表发现MySQL服务不在运行
net stop mysql

【数据库】Window环境安装MySQL Server 5.7.21相关推荐

  1. mysql 从入门到精通之 Linux环境安装mysql数据库

    提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录 1.安装MySQL数据库 1.1. 下载mysql安装包 1.2. 上传并解压mysql安装包 1.3.添加系统mysql用 ...

  2. Windows环境安装MySQL步骤

    Windows环境安装MySQL步骤 前言 1.下载安装包 2.安装 3.工具连接 前言 说明:如果电脑上已经有MySQL数据库,就不用安装了,不管是Windows还是Linux或者Docker的,不 ...

  3. win10家庭版无法安装mysql_大师处置win10系统家庭版安装MySQL server 5.7.19失败的详细办法...

    随着电脑的使用率越来越高,我们有时候可能会遇到win10系统家庭版安装MySQL server 5.7.19失败的情况,想必大家都遇到过win10系统家庭版安装MySQL server 5.7.19失 ...

  4. window 自动安装MySQL数据库_windows安装MySQL数据库

    windows安装MySQL数据库 最终效果展示 具体步骤 打开MySQL官网,找到downloads 选择MySQL社区版 选择MySQL Community Server社区器 选择windows ...

  5. linux安装mysql.rpm软件包_Linux环境安装MySQL数据库(RPM格式的软件包)

    1.  下载mysql安装包 2.解压已下载的mysql安装包,安装包根据自己需要进行安装.(本人使用mysql 5.5版本测试) 3.先检查本机是否有安装mysql数据库,再使用rpm命令进行安装, ...

  6. Linux环境安装mysql数据库详细教程(含卸载和密码重置过程)

    本教程适用于centos7/8,mysql 5.x 1.卸载mysql(重要) 在安装mysql之前要确保自己的系统中没有mysql,即使你是刚刚重装的系统或者是刚购买的云服务,也需要检查一下是否存在 ...

  7. window上安装mysql_在window上安装mysql - MySQL5.7.24 版本

    1.下载安装包 下载地址:https://dev.mysql.com/downloads/mysql/5.7.html#downloads 备注:选择对应你电脑的版本,现在一般都是64位的电脑 2.解 ...

  8. 数据库概述(了解数据库,当前数据库介绍,mysql数据库介绍,安装mysql数据库)

    文章目录 数据库概述 什么是数据库(数据,表,数据库) 数据库有什么作用? 关系数据库详解 非关系数据库详解 数据库系统发展史 数据库管理系统(DBMS) 当今主流数据库介绍 MySQL数据库 MyS ...

  9. linux mysql 主从数据库_Linux下安装MySQL及MySQL主从同步配置

    从零开始说起,先说在Linux安装MySQL再说主从配置,MySQL的版本为5.7 一.mysql安装 1.使用命令 rpm -qa|grep mariadb 查看是否存在mariadb 2. 使用 ...

最新文章

  1. Linux查看端口号是否使用
  2. python是多模型语言_Django多语言post模型
  3. ios相机内存_ios 12功能大升级,快来体验内存释放、相机特效
  4. linux 切换root_Linux运维服务篇:流量监控工具iftop部署及详细参数分享
  5. [SQL SERVER 2005]数据库差异备份及还原
  6. 华为鸿蒙平板界面,华为工作人员曝光:鸿蒙OS正式版,平板手机将采用全新UI界面...
  7. 为jquery.AutoComplete添加触发事件
  8. struts2学习笔记(二) 初识Struts2
  9. 基于深度卷积神经网络的农作物病害识别
  10. PDF编辑器(PDF Editor)中文版
  11. macos 设置内外网同时访问
  12. 《分布式机器学习:算法、理论与实践》
  13. linux命令批量修改文件名称
  14. 记一次查深圳磨房百公里徒步照片历程
  15. git bash粘贴快捷键
  16. 关于临时指针变量和其他临时变量的区别
  17. 地理信息可视化大数据系统分析
  18. UBUNTU系统设置窗口打不开解决办法(精)
  19. 使用同步锁来实现线程安全---生产者与消费者
  20. excel 批量翻译-excel 批量函数公司翻译大全免费

热门文章

  1. stm32f429vref怎么接_STM32如何通过内部VREF得到实际的VDDA值
  2. php 事件调度,PHP单元测试调度事件
  3. aix vnc oracle,请问如何配置AIX上的vnc
  4. java想要生成 字符串,如何在Java中“优雅地”生成String?
  5. Java8————日期时间 API
  6. zabbix mysql脚本_zabbix监控mysql脚本
  7. 网络编程与分层协议设计:基于linux平台实现,网络编程与分层协议设计:基于Linux平台实现...
  8. 如何让小程序页面更顺滑_小程序怎样让wx.navigateBack更好用的方法实现
  9. HTML+CSS+JS实现 ❤️CSS3图片遮罩高亮显示❤️
  10. 计算机系统军训口号,霸气的军训口号大全